package havp tags 479891 fixed-upstream thank you The havp homepage announces version 0.88 with this changelog: HAVP 0.88 released - ClamAV library 0.93 support (recompile needed, new option CLAMMAXSCANSIZE) - CLAMMAXFILESIZE default is now 100MB (so 0.93 even starts scanning big files) - Fix random seed issue (ClamAV generated some temporary file errors) - Added DISABLELOCKINGFOR config (fix for ZIP handling in ClamAV 0.93) - Arcavir version 2008 support (set ARCAVIRVERSION) - Log scanner errors to errorlog - Relaxed SSL/CONNECT port limits (It is _not_ recommended to use --enable-ssl-tunnel, you should use Squid) best regards Björn -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to [EMAIL PROTECTED] with a subject of unsubscribe. Am Sonntag, den 02.10.2005, 07:01 -0700 schrieb Jeremy Dinsel: When I look at http://ftp-master.debian.org/new.html, I see that gtkhtml3.8 is waiting (3 weeks), but I cannot see libgtkhtml3.8-15 or libgal2.6-common. Do you know what may be causing these two packages from appearing in ftp-master? What you see on the new-list are _source_ packages, while libgtkhtml3.8-15 and libgal2.6-common are _binary_ packages. They are build from gtkhtml3.8 and gal2.6, respectively. HTH, Björn
